Usulután Facts
| Area | 118.7 km² |
| Population | 74,821 |
| Male Population | 34,742 (46.4%) |
| Female Population | 40,079 (53.6%) |
| Population change (1975 to 2020) | +60.3% |
| Population change (2000 to 2020) | +9.1% |
| Median Age | 23.3 years (Male: 21.1, Female: 25.2) |
| GDP per capita (PPP) | $8,033 (2022) |
| Neighborhoods | Barrio La Merced, Barrio EL MOLINO, Colonia Los Santos, Colonia LOS NARANJOS, Residencial El Calvario |

Usulután Median Age
Median Age: 23.3 years
| Location | Median Age | Median Age (Female) | Median Age (Male)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Usulután | 23.3 yrs | 25.2 yrs | 21.1 yrs |
| Usulután Department | 21.8 yrs | 23.6 yrs | 19.9 yrs |
| El Salvador | 23.3 yrs | 24.9 yrs | 21.5 yrs |
Usulután Population Density
Population Density: 630 / km²
| Location | Population | Area | Density |
|---|---|---|---|
| Usulután | 74,821 | 118.7 km² | 630 / km² |
| Usulután Department | 354,779 | 2,026.7 km² | 175 / km² |
| El Salvador | 6.1 million | 20,749.8 km² | 295 / km² |

Natural Hazards Risk
Relative risk out of 10
| Hazard | Risk Level |
|---|---|
| Flood | High (9) |
| Earthquake | High (8) |
| Landslide | High (9) |
| Volcano | High (9) |
* Risk, particularly concerning flood or landslide, may not be for the entire area.
